Spring Web Application으로 프로젝트를 진행할 때 java에서 넘겨온 값을 이용하여 jsp단계에서 쓰고 싶은 일이 있을 것이다.


이 때 ModelMap객체를 이용해서 간단하게 사용할 수 있다.



[JAVA]


@RequestMapping(value = { "/sample/page" })
public String index(@RequestParam Map<String,String> params, ModelMap model, Locale locale, Authentication auth) {
Calendar calendar = Calendar.getInstance();
java.util.Date date = calendar.getTime();
String today = (new SimpleDateFormat("yyyy.MM.dd HH:mm").format(date));

model.put("nowDate",today); //모델맵 객체에 현재 시간을 input함

model.put("id","2"); //모델맵 객체에 id라는 키로 input함

return "index";

}



[JSP]


<p id="nowDate" style="margin-bottom:auto;">${nowDate}</p>


[JavaScript]


var pageId = "${id}";



'개발' 카테고리의 다른 글

인텔리제이에서 Git연결  (0) 2018.12.06
구글 폰트 사용  (0) 2018.12.03
[JAVA] String 비교  (0) 2018.11.29
[JAVA] rest api 결과값 받아와서 처리하기 - RestTemplate  (0) 2018.11.29
구글 검색엔진에 최적화하기!  (0) 2018.11.28

+ Recent posts